> >   Log:
> >   Unbreak on 6.0, thanks to compat5x.
> >   
> >   Note: the following entry is still required in /etc/libmap.conf:
> >   libm.so.2               libm.so.3
> 
> Does this mean that compat5x should also include libm.so.2?

No!  libm.so.2 was never part of RELENG_5.  Someone has built this binary
on a -CURRENT system, which is something we don't really support.  If I
maintained this port, I would binary edit it to depend on libm.so.3 or
libc.so.4 - which ever was most appropriate.
